Reducing Investment and Operating Costs for Cleanrooms and Dry Rooms
Cleanrooms and dry rooms represent a major cost driver in battery manufacturing, given their high capital and operating expenditures. MPC focusses on the efficient design of these areas to reduce costs without compromising required cleanliness standards. By optimizing cleanroom processes and implementing innovative technologies, both investment and operational costs can be significantly reduced, thereby improving the overall profitability of production facilities.
Designing and Assessing Resilient End-to-End Supply Chains for Equipment and Materials
A robust and efficient supply chain is a critical success factor in battery production. It is not sufficient to ensure the reliable provision of “clean” equipment and materials alone - the entire supply Chain must be designed to remain resilient and efficient. Packaging plays a key role, as it directly affects product quality under stringent cleanliness requirements. Through precise planning of cleanroom zones and transition areas, product contamination can be avoided while maintaining process integrity. MPC helps to design supply chains that remain stable even in times of disruption while ensuring the highest product quality.
